Very nice project! To protect your eqpt from trailer rollover you can make a rotating section on the drawbar with a large bolt and nut. Here's a pic of a small drawbar (on a snowmobile trailer) that uses a 7/8" bolt for pivot. It simply rotates on the threads. If you could find a 1 1/2 inch diameter thread + nut it would probably fit your needs well and low cost.

For scale, this drawbar on this snowmobile trailer is 1 1/2" square tube.
